- Primary hostplants
-
Family Latin name Vernacular name Salicaceae Populus alba White Poplar Salicaceae Populus canescens Grey poplar
- Synonyms and other combinations
-
Latin name Author Nepticula turbidella Zeller, 1848 Nepticula populialbae Hering, 1935 Stigmella marionella Ford, 1950
- Ectoedemia (E.) turbidella is a member of the clade Ectoedemia populella:
-
Species Author Ectoedemia (E.) argyropeza (Zeller, 1839) Ectoedemia (E.) hannoverella (Glitz, 1872) Ectoedemia (E.) intimella (Zeller, 1848) Ectoedemia (E.) klimeschi (Skala, 1933) Ectoedemia (E.) similigena Puplesis, 1994 Ectoedemia (E.) turbidella (Zeller, 1848)
